CNA announced that Robert Ivey, who recently joined the company as branch vice president of its Philadelphia office, has also been appointed branch vice president of its Reading, Pennsylvania office.
In his new position, Ivey has continued responsibility for expanding CNA’s profitable growth and producer relationships throughout Eastern Pennsylvania.
